Anyon black holes

open access: yesPhysics Letters B, 2018
We propose a correspondence between an Anyon Van der Waals fluid and a (2+1) dimensional AdS black hole. Anyons are particles with intermediate statistics that interpolates between a Fermi–Dirac statistics and a Bose–Einstein one.

A non-classical van der Waals loop: Collective variables method [PDF]

open access: yesCondensed Matter Physics, 2013
The equation of state is investigated for an Ising-like model in the framework of collective variables method. The peculiar feature of the theory is that a non-classical van der Waals loop is obtained.

Critical constants correlation from van der Waals equation

open access: yesIngeniería y Ciencia, 2019
The cubic van der Waals equation of state at the critical condition is reduced to a linear function (Vc vs. Tc /Pc coordinates) with one adjustable parameter.

Critical behavior and microscopic structure of charged AdS black holes via an alternative phase space

open access: yesPhysics Letters B, 2017
It has been argued that charged Anti-de Sitter (AdS) black holes have similar thermodynamic behavior as the Van der Waals fluid system, provided one treats the cosmological constant as a thermodynamic variable (pressure) in an extended phase space.
